Hướng dẫn what to do after learning python basics reddit - phải làm gì sau khi học kiến ​​thức cơ bản về python reddit

Hướng dẫn what to do after learning python basics reddit - phải làm gì sau khi học kiến ​​thức cơ bản về python reddit

cấp độ 1

Tôi có một bài đăng trên blog Tôi biết những điều cơ bản của Python, tiếp theo là gì? có liên kết tài nguyên cho các bài tập, dự án, gỡ lỗi, thử nghiệm, trăn trung gian/nâng cao, thuật toán, mẫu thiết kế, gian lận, v.v.

Tôi khuyên bạn nên giải quyết các bài tập và thực hiện một số dự án (đặc biệt là một cái gì đó giải quyết vấn đề trong thế giới thực cho bạn) trước khi chuyển sang các khóa học trung gian.

cấp độ 1

Các dự án là cách tốt nhất để tôi học sau khi tôi có những điều cơ bản. Tìm một cái gì đó bạn nghĩ sẽ rất tuyệt, và làm điều đó. Đừng bỏ cuộc khi khó khăn, vì nó sẽ. Tìm ra cách giải quyết những vấn đề đó là giai đoạn "ngoài người mới bắt đầu".

Tôi thận trọng chống lại sự điên rồ với quá nhiều khóa học. Nó giúp đến một điểm, nhưng rất nhiều người bị cuốn vào "Địa ngục hướng dẫn", nơi họ đã xem 175 video hướng dẫn, nhưng vẫn không thể viết một vòng lặp mà không kiểm tra cú pháp. Chỉ cần thực hiện một mục tiêu làm việc trên một dự án nhỏ một cách thường xuyên. Khi những dự án nhỏ trở nên nhàm chán, hãy làm một cái gì đó phức tạp hơn. Chỉ cần tiếp tục viết mã.

cấp độ 2

Bạn có thể đưa ra một số ví dụ về các dự án để tôi làm không?

cấp độ 1

Một khi bạn có những điều cơ bản, không có thêm các khóa học. Bắt đầu làm một cái gì đó. Một dự án sẽ dạy cho bạn nhiều hơn 100 lần so với mọi hướng dẫn từng có.

cấp độ 2

Bạn có thể đưa ra một số ví dụ về các dự án để tôi làm không?

Một khi bạn có những điều cơ bản, không có thêm các khóa học. Bắt đầu làm một cái gì đó. Một dự án sẽ dạy cho bạn nhiều hơn 100 lần so với mọi hướng dẫn từng có.Create an API

Này, tôi nghĩ rằng bạn đang cố gắng tìm ra một dự án để làm; Làm thế nào về cái này?

Dự án: Tạo API

Tôi nghĩ rằng đó là một dự án đầy thách thức cho bạn! Hãy thử nó nhưng, đừng nản lòng. Nếu bạn cần thêm hướng dẫn, đây là một mô tả:

cấp độ 1

Tạo API bằng cách sử dụng khung như Flask hoặc Django

cấp độ 2

Bạn có thể đưa ra một số ví dụ về các dự án để tôi làm không?

cấp độ 1

Một khi bạn có những điều cơ bản, không có thêm các khóa học. Bắt đầu làm một cái gì đó. Một dự án sẽ dạy cho bạn nhiều hơn 100 lần so với mọi hướng dẫn từng có.

cấp độ 2

Bạn có thể đưa ra một số ví dụ về các dự án để tôi làm không?

Một khi bạn có những điều cơ bản, không có thêm các khóa học. Bắt đầu làm một cái gì đó. Một dự án sẽ dạy cho bạn nhiều hơn 100 lần so với mọi hướng dẫn từng có.Random Wikipedia Article

Này, tôi nghĩ rằng bạn đang cố gắng tìm ra một dự án để làm; Làm thế nào về cái này?

Dự án: Tạo API

Tôi nghĩ rằng đó là một dự án đầy thách thức cho bạn! Hãy thử nó nhưng, đừng nản lòng. Nếu bạn cần thêm hướng dẫn, đây là một mô tả:

cấp độ 2

Bạn có thể đưa ra một số ví dụ về các dự án để tôi làm không?

Một khi bạn có những điều cơ bản, không có thêm các khóa học. Bắt đầu làm một cái gì đó. Một dự án sẽ dạy cho bạn nhiều hơn 100 lần so với mọi hướng dẫn từng có.Python Website Blocker

Này, tôi nghĩ rằng bạn đang cố gắng tìm ra một dự án để làm; Làm thế nào về cái này?

Dự án: Tạo API

Tôi nghĩ rằng đó là một dự án đầy thách thức cho bạn! Hãy thử nó nhưng, đừng nản lòng. Nếu bạn cần thêm hướng dẫn, đây là một mô tả:

Học một ngôn ngữ thực như C, nếu bạn không lật các bit bằng kim bằng kim từ hóa, bạn có thực sự là một lập trình viên không?

LOL nhưng tất cả đều đùa giỡn, tôi khuyên bạn nên giới thiệu 2 điều tùy thuộc vào nơi bạn muốn đi với mã hóa của mình (mặc dù cả hai sẽ là tốt nhất):

  1. Nếu bạn muốn tập trung vào kịch bản/thực tế các ứng dụng mỗi ngày, hãy xem:

    1. Python bạo lực Một cuốn sách nấu ăn miễn phí cho các tin tặc điều hành bạn thông qua kịch bản nâng cao cho cuộc sống thực/sử dụng an ninh mạng.

    2. Chỉ cần chơi xung quanh với ngôn ngữ - thực hành tự động hóa mọi thứ và tạo ra các ứng dụng đơn giản của riêng bạn.

  2. Nếu bạn ít tham gia vào kịch bản và viết nhiều hơn các chương trình đầy đủ cho các cơ sở mã lớn vì bạn muốn có một công việc lập trình:

    1. Trước tiên hãy xem https://www.hackerrank.com/domains/python, đây là danh sách các thách thức lập trình sẽ giúp bạn phù hợp hơn với ngôn ngữ.

    2. Sau đó, hãy xem danh sách các dự án GitHub đơn giản này https://github.com/mungell/awgie-for-beginners#python, tìm một cái mà bạn thích và bắt đầu nghiên cứu nó.

      1. Lần đầu tiên tải xuống nó, chơi xung quanh và hiểu nó từ một cấp độ cao

      2. Sau đó làm việc theo cách của bạn, hiểu tất cả các tệp làm gì, sau đó cuối cùng phân tích mã nguồn trực tiếp.

      3. Khi bạn đủ thoải mái với mã, hãy thử xem theo tab các vấn đề trong dự án và xem liệu bạn có thể giải quyết một số vấn đề không. Nếu bạn hoàn toàn khắc phục sự cố trên máy của mình, bạn có thể thử đẩy nó và hy vọng rằng nó được chấp nhận.issues tab on the project, and see if you can solve some of the problems. If you sucessfully fix the problem on your machine, you can try pushing it and hoping that it gets accepted.

      4. Rửa sạch và lặp lại với một loạt các dự án mà bạn quan tâm.

      5. Khi bạn đã thực hiện tất cả những điều này, bạn sẽ biết Python từ trong ra ngoài và biết bạn muốn đi đâu với chương trình của mình.

P.S. Chỉ cần một khuyến nghị: Dự án tốt nhất cho người mới bắt đầu hoàn thành Too Earn On có lẽ là Zulip. Đó là một ứng dụng trò chuyện Python tự lưu trữ, đủ phổ biến được sử dụng bởi các công ty Fortune 500.

Nó có cơ sở mã đơn giản và ~ 1200 lỗi/vấn đề mở cho các bạn cũng học, vì vậy đây có lẽ là dự án đầu tiên tốt nhất nếu bạn chưa có điều gì đó trong tâm trí.

Từ github:

Mã đóng góp. Kiểm tra hướng dẫn của chúng tôi cho những người đóng góp mới để bắt đầu. Zulip tự hào về việc duy trì một cơ sở mã sạch và được thử nghiệm tốt, và hàng trăm vấn đề thân thiện với người mới bắt đầu.. Check out our guide for new contributors to get started. Zulip prides itself on maintaining a clean and well-tested codebase, and a stock of hundreds of beginner-friendly issues.

Phải làm gì sau khi hoàn thành những điều cơ bản của Python?

Ngoài các cơ hội nghề nghiệp Python trên, bạn cũng có thể đăng ký các vị trí của nhà phát triển Stack Full Stack, nhà phân tích nghiên cứu, nhà khoa học dữ liệu, cố vấn tài chính, kỹ sư đảm bảo chất lượng, nhà phân tích GIS, nhà khoa học dữ liệu và các nhà khoa học khác.Python full stack developer, research analysts, data scientists, financial advisors, quality assurance engineer, GIS Analyst, data scientist, and others.

Tôi nên làm gì sau khi học những điều cơ bản của Python Reddit?

Điều tốt nhất để làm là sử dụng nó.Ở giai đoạn này, bạn sẽ tìm hiểu nhiều hơn bằng cách viết các chương trình hơn bạn sẽ đọc sách.Bắt đầu với một số chương trình mới bắt đầu, sau đó bắt đầu xem xét các loại chương trình bạn muốn thực hiện và tìm kiếm những mô -đun bạn cần cho chúng.use it. At this stage you'll learn more by writing programs than you will by reading books. Start out with some beginner programs, then start looking into what types of programs you want to make and looking up what modules you need for those.

Khóa học tiếp theo sau những điều cơ bản của Python là gì?

Vì vậy, bạn nên học HTML, CSS, một chút JavaScript và Django để trở thành một nhà phát triển web đầy đủ (người có thể tạo một ứng dụng web hoàn chỉnh).Tuy nhiên, những điều này không khó như bạn nghĩ.Học phát triển web sẽ dễ dàng, vui vẻ và giải trí.HTML, CSS, a bit of Javascript, and Django to become a full-stack web developer (the one who can create a complete web application). However, these are not as difficult as you may think. Learning web development will be easy, fun, and entertaining.

Làm thế nào để bạn tiếp tục học Python sau những điều cơ bản?

Nếu bạn đã học những điều cơ bản của Python.Nhảy vào một chút phát triển web, trước đó hiểu cách hoạt động của web ...
Tìm hiểu khung Django trong Python ..
Tìm hiểu Multitreadind trong Python ..
Học GUI trong Python ..
Học mạng trong Python ..